Introduction. Theology in a world of specialization / Erik Borgman, Felix Wilfred -- The social background to the process of differentiation in society and the life worlds of human beings / Karl Gabriel -- Theology in the modern university: whither specialization? / Felix Wilfred -- Theology and religious studies in an age of fragmentation / Sheila Greeve Davaney -- 'Many have undertaken-- and I too decided': the one story or the many? / Elaine Wainwright -- Theological ethics without theology: assessing theological-ethical reflection of moral challenges posed by pluralism in relation to theology / Christoph Baumgartner -- Church history without God or without faith? / Willem Frijhoff -- From shaken foundations to a different integrity: spirituality as response to fragmentation / Mary Grey -- Theologies of the South: incarnate and holistic / Diego Irarrazabal -- Who framed Clodovis Boff?: revisiting the controversy of 'theologies of the genitive' in the twenty-first century / Marcella Althaus-Reid -- Theology in relation to the natural sciences / Palmyre Oomen -- Theology and the social sciences / Richard H. Roberts -- Saving doctrine: towards a theology of health and medicine / Stephan van Erp -- Theology: discipline at the limits / Erik Borgman.
